📖 Definitions of "Rotary"
noun
- 1
A traffic circle.
- 2
(chiefly with initial capital) Any of the clubs making up the international Rotary International movement for community service.
adjective
- 1
Capable of rotation.
"A rotary engine revolves the heads rather than having pistons go back and forth."
